Super Earth Goods
Super Earth Goods is a green accessories company hailing from Indonesia, the fourth most populous country in the world. With all those people comes a whole lot of waste, a problem this sustainable label looks to reduce.

Super Earth Goods workers visit second-hand stores, markets, garages, and other local sites in search of discarded items needing a new lease on life. It upcycles these materials to create green handbags and footwear including laptop sleeves from rice sacks and men’s shirts, shopping bags made from used tire tubes, and drawstring duffels made from coffee sacks.

It might sound a bit icky to create accessories from trash, but the green materials are washed thoroughly before being hand-assembled by Indonesian families. This process results in items that are as fashionable and functional as they are eco-friendly. And as Super Earth Goods uses found objects, each accessory is a true original with tons of character.

Super Earth Goods accessories are available from selected stores in Indonesia, Singapore, and The Netherlands, as well as the label’s online store and the Bottica website. Pieces start at €25 for the label’s straw beach bag and top €175 for the Camo Bag made from a vintage army shirt with recycled truck tire tube straps.

Amalia Mattaor Dancing Bags | Unusual Futuristic Fish Leather Shoulder Bags

Posted on: Jul 4

Amalia Mattaor Dancing Bag

French designer Amalia Mattaor has reinvented the shoulder bag with her clever nightclub ready Dancing Bags.

The unusual purses were designed with keen club hoppers in mind. They strap onto the shoulder, keeping your essentials safe without restricting your mobility on the dance floor. The futuristic, fierce designs are really like an extension of the body, and would look gorgeous paired with edgy nightclub attire.

The Dancing Bags are made from leather, but the skin is more eco-conscious than the average. Most skins come from edible fish, including salmon and eel, so there’s no waste of the animals. These materials are as soft and comfortable as their more traditional cowhide and lambskin counterparts, but they’re much more sustainable.

I love the look of these glamorous, rebellious bags but I can’t help worrying that they won’t do exactly what they say on the tin. I’m not sure what’s to stop many of them sliding down your arm when you’re really grooving. Perhaps you’d have to strap them on really tightly, but that doesn’t seem comfortable.

Amalia Mattaor’s Dancing Bags are available at Showroom Fabre in Paris, France, and The Nexus Townhouse and Showroom New York. I can’t find any prices online, which suggests to me that you’re bound to pay a pretty penny for these innovative accessories!

Graze Organic’s New Lunch Totes | Organic Cotton Label Makes Eco-Friendly Meal Bags

Posted on: Jul 3

Graze Organic Lunch TotesForget boring brown paper bags and carry your meals in style with the new lunch totes from Graze Organic.

The silk-screened front and back designs are what draw you in: there are pink flowers for the girly girls, robots for young boys and the men who’ve never grown up, and the Because Every Bag Matters print for eco-conscious eaters.

Each one is made in the United States from tough organic cotton and printed with water-based inks. The material is as easy to care for as it is green. If your drink bottle or container of leftovers leaks you can simply throw the tote in the washing machine. It’ll also withstand a trip through the tumble dryer when you’re done.

However it’s worth noting that these lunch totes are not lined, so any leaks may get messy. It makes sense as water-resistant materials like plastic aren’t generally environmentally friendly, but there may be occasions when we miss those properties.

The Graze Organic lunch totes measure 11.5 x 7.5 x 5 inches, so they’re large enough to hold waste-free food containers and reusable bottles, or even one of Graze Organic’s own cloth napkins.

The Graze Organic lunch totes are available for $29.95 from the Graze Organic website.

Collina Strada Reinvents Bags for KAIGHT | Organic Designer Goes Vegan

Posted on: Jul 3

Collina Strada Kaight Bags

Eco-friendly accessories label Collina Strada has created a trio of sustainable biker-chic bags exclusively for New York City’s KAIGHT.

The edgy handbags are made in the City that Never Sleeps from recycled canvas and faux leather colored with eco-friendly inks. Fans of Collina Strada would be familiar with the Cartella, Moto, and Sierra designs. However the vegan material used here should please animal loving girls who shun the label’s usual organic leather.

One of those women is a KAIGHT’s sales associates who loved Collina Strada’s designs but felt frustrated they were made of real vegetable-tanned leather. Like many animal activists she did not use or wear genuine leather products, and could not indulge in the designs while remaining true to her principles.

It really brought home the fact that many who choose not to wear leather aren’t able to purchase or wear many of the trendier, fun designers and have to opt for only vegan labels,” explained KAIGHT’s proprietor Kate McGregor.

The vegan Collina Strada purses are available from KAIGHT’s stores, including its website, now. With prices starting at $265 they’re on the high side, but knowing that 10% of the proceeds will benefit Brooklyn’s BARC Animal Shelter should make it a bit easier to part with your cash.
